Since one equation has a positive y and the other a negative y we can simply add the two equations together to solve for x...
(4x-y=5)+(3x+y=16)
7x=21,
x=3, now you can use either original equation to solve for y...
3x+y=16 becomes:
3(3)+y=16
9+y=16
y=7
So the solution is the point (3,7)
